Blockchain technology, originally created for the digital currency Bitcoin, has evolved to become a decentralized and secure system for recording transactions across a network of computers. Its applications extend far beyond cryptocurrencies, encompassing sectors such as finance, healthcare, supply chain management, and more. Blockchain's key features, including transparency, immutability, and security, have made it a game-changer in the digital age. In the realm of STEM, blockchain engineering plays a crucial role in developing and maintaining blockchain networks. Blockchain engineers are responsible for designing protocols, developing smart contracts, ensuring network security, and optimizing blockchain performance. These professionals combine their expertise in computer science, cryptography, and distributed systems to create innovative solutions that leverage blockchain technology. The integration of blockchain engineering in STEM opens up endless possibilities for revolutionizing traditional processes and systems. For instance, in healthcare, blockchain technology can improve data security and interoperability, enabling secure sharing of patient records among healthcare providers. In the supply chain industry, blockchain can enhance transparency and traceability, reducing fraud and ensuring the authenticity of products.
